Macaroni and Cheese Recipe

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
50 g / 3 1/2 tbsp butter
3 tbsp flour
2 cups milk (full fat preferred but low fat is ok)
2 1/2 cups water
250 g / 2 1/2 cups elbow macaroni , uncooked
3/4 cup mozzarella cheese , shredded
1 1/2 cups cheese (Cheddar, Colby, Gruyere) , shredded (Note 1)
Salt and pepper
Seasonings (optional)
1 tsp garlic powder
1/2 tsp onion powder
1/2 tsp mustard powder

Directions:
Directions:
Melt butter in a medium pot or large saucepan over medium heat. Add flour and cook for 1 minute.
Add about 3/4 cup of milk and mix into butter mixture - it will become a slurry pretty quickly.
Add remaining milk and mix so the slurry mixes in. Then add water and Seasonings.
Add macaroni and mix. Stir occasionally as it comes to heat. When you see wisps of steam as you stir, lower the heat down to medium low.
Stir regularly as it cooks for 9 - 10 minutes (it will bubble gently), or until the sauce thickens and the macaroni is just cooked - tender but still firm. It should still be saucey at this stage and thinner than you want.
Take it off the stove and stir the cheese in quickly. Adjust salt and pepper to taste. <- In this step, the sauce thickens and reduces considerably.
Serve immediately!!
